How Salesforce Data 360 Pricing Is Structured
Before determining a realistic budget, it is important to understand the underlying structure of the pricing model. The following sections outline how each component fits together.
Data 360 Uses a Hybrid Pricing Model
Most Salesforce products follow a familiar rule: pay per user, per month or per year, done. Data Cloud breaks that mold.
Salesforce Data 360 pricing combines three distinct layers:
A fixed subscription (the core license)
Optional add-ons you attach based on your needs
Usage-based credits that get consumed as the platform actually processes your data
Example: Buying a car. You pay a fixed price for the vehicle itself, you pay extra for accessories like a roof rack or upgraded trim, and then you pay for gasoline based on how much you actually drive.
Data Cloud works the same way: the "car" is your core license, the "accessories" are your add-ons, and the "gasoline" is your credit consumption.
Why Data 360 licensing is different from traditional Salesforce Licensing
Traditional Salesforce licensing is based on the number of users who need access. Data Cloud is different. It does not charge based on the number of users. It charges based on how much work the platform does.
Every time your org performs actions like:
Data ingestion: Pulling records into Data 360 from your systems
Identity Resolution: Merging and matching customer records into unified profiles
Segmentation: Building audience segments from unified data
Activation: Pushing those segments out to advertising or marketing platforms
Credits are charged in addition to your subscription and add-ons. This is the Flex Credits consumption model, and it drives Data Cloud's overall cost.
Data 360 is not a per-user license with a flat annual fee. It is a subscription-plus-usage model, where credits, not seats, make up a large part of your total cost.
Three Main Cost Categories in Salesforce Data 360
Salesforce Data Cloud pricing is built from three separate cost components, each billed and renewed differently. Understanding what each one covers makes it easier to see where your actual spend comes from.
1. Core License
This is the upfront, fixed-cost layer, usually renewed every year. It sets up the core Data Cloud capabilities in your Salesforce org and includes an initial amount of credits and storage. Data 360 runs on top of your existing Salesforce edition (Enterprise, Performance, Unlimited, or Developer).
Most orgs purchase the standard Data Cloud License. There is also a newer license called the "Companion Org," which lets one org connect to an existing Data 360 instance instead of setting up its own
2. Add-On Licenses
These are optional, fixed-cost extras layered on top of your core license, usually renewed yearly alongside it. Common add-ons include:
| Add-On | What It Does |
|---|---|
| Data Spaces | Partitions your data by region, brand, or business unit. |
| Segmentation & Activation | Enables audience segment creation and batch activation. |
| Extra Storage Allocation | Additional storage beyond your initial entitlement. |
| Private Connect for Data Cloud | Secure private connectivity to external systems. |
| Platform Encryption | Customer-managed encryption keys for Data Cloud. |
| Advertising Audiences | Required to activate segments to platforms like Google Ads or Meta. |
| Sub-Second Real-Time Profile & Entities | Real-time processing for Identity Resolution, Data Graphs, and audience segments. |
Many Data Cloud services, including identity resolution, segmentation, activation, and data integration, can be enabled through core capabilities and optional add-ons.
3. Consumption-Based Credits
This part of the cost varies with usage. You can say it pay-as-you-go layer, carries the most complexity and the most budget risk.
Most actions in Data 360 use credits. Credit use depends on how much data is processed. Examples include ingesting a data stream, running a Calculated Insight, and publishing a segment.
How Salesforce Data 360 Credits Work
Salesforce Data Cloud Credits are charged according to the data processing activities of your business. Unlike charging per feature, Salesforce charges based on the amount of processing detected across different steps in the customer data lifecycle.
1. Harmonize and Merge
Prepare customer data from different sources by cleaning, processing, converting, and merging them into a single customer profile.
The activities consuming credits at this stage are:
Batch processing of data
Streaming processing of data
Batch merging of profiles
2. Analyze and Predict
Extract insights and enrich customer profiles with calculated metrics and AI predictions.
The credit-consuming activities are:
Batch calculated insights
Streaming calculated insights
Inferences
3. Execute
Retrieving merged customer data and executing instant activities in Salesforce or alongside connected applications.
The credit-consuming activities are:
Data inquiries
Streaming actions, including lookups
4. Segment and Activate
Create customer audiences and activate them across marketing, sales, service, and external platforms.
Credit-consuming activities include:
Segment Rows Processed
Batch Activation
Activate DMO – Streaming
5. End-to-End Real-Time Processing
Support real-time customer experiences by processing profile updates and API requests as events occur.
Credit-consuming activities include:
Real-Time Profile Processing
Real-Time API Requests
As your data volume and processing frequency increase, so does your credit consumption. Monitoring these workloads is key to avoiding unexpected costs.
How Salesforce Calculates Your Data 360 Credit Usage
Salesforce calculates Data 360 credit consumption based on three factors:
Usage Type: The operation being performed (such as data transformation, calculated insights, segmentation, or activation).
Unit of Usage: Data 360 measures usage in units of 1 million records.
Credit Multiplier: Each usage type has a predefined multiplier that determines how many credits are consumed for every one million records processed.
The formula is:
Credits Consumed = (Records Processed ÷ 1,000,000) × Credit Multiplier
Example: Batch Calculated Insight
Suppose you create a Batch Calculated Insight on 2 million records, and the credit multiplier for this operation is 15.
Calculation:
Records Processed = 2,000,000
Unit = 1,000,000 records
Multiplier = 15
Credits Consumed = (2,000,000 ÷ 1,000,000) × 15 = 30 Credits
Now assume the calculated insight refreshes the next day, and your dataset has grown to 2.2 million records.
Credits Consumed = (2,200,000 ÷ 1,000,000) × 15 = 33 Credits
This means that credit consumption increases as your data volume grows. Since calculated insights, identity resolution, segmentation, and activation often run on a recurring schedule, organizations should monitor both processing frequency and data growth to accurately forecast Data Cloud costs.
Note: The credit multiplier varies by workload. Salesforce publishes the current multipliers in its Data Cloud Rate Card, so always refer to the latest documentation when estimating costs.
Factors That Affect Your Total Data Cloud Cost
A handful of variables tend to swing the final bill more than anything else:
Data volume and growth rate: More rows ingested and processed means more credits, every single time a process runs.
Refresh frequency: How often you re-run Identity Resolution, refresh Calculated Insights, or re-publish segments directly multiplies your consumption.
Source type: External data pipelines cost noticeably more per row than native Salesforce connectors (Marketing Cloud, CRM, Commerce Cloud).
Real-time vs. batch processing: Streaming and sub-second real-time actions carry much higher multipliers than their batch equivalents.
Add-on selection: Features like Advertising Audiences or Private Connect add fixed annual cost regardless of usage.
Delta volume over time: Incremental daily growth compounds quickly across months, especially since multiple downstream processes, not just ingestion, re-touch that same new data
This is really the heart of any Data Cloud TCO exercise. Total cost of ownership here isn't just the license invoice; it's the compounding effect of usage patterns stretched across 12, 24, or 36 months.
How to Monitor Data 360 Credit Usage
By monitoring credit consumption in the Data 360, you can see your credit consumption, recognize sudden increases, and obtain forecasts to aid in future planning without incurring any unexpected expenses.
The Salesforce platform has many built-in monitoring tools that can help the administrator track the overall consumption of the Ingested Data Cloud credits.
What to Monitor
Total credits consumed over a selected time period.
Credit usage by workload, including data transformations, calculated insights, segmentation, and activation.
Data processing volumes to see how many records are being processed.
Scheduled jobs and refresh frequency, as recurring processes can significantly impact credit consumption.
Usage trends over time to identify growth patterns and forecast future credit needs.
Best Practices to Optimise Data Cloud Costs
The following practices help keep Data 360 costs predictable and manageable.
| Best Practice | Why It Matters |
|---|---|
| Plan your data strategy early | Map out data volume, refresh frequency, and use-case scope with a Salesforce Partner before implementation. |
| Track every processing run | Ingestion refreshes, segment publishes, and recalculations all consume credits. |
| Limit Identity Resolution refreshes | Its multiplier is the highest, so plan refresh frequency carefully. |
| Ingest only what you need | Unused historical data adds cost without delivering value. |
| Forecast delta growth | Daily incremental data volume compounds quickly over time. |
| Pre-transform data upstream | Clean and shape data before it reaches Data 360 to reduce credit consumption. |
